Boys reach puberty at different times. At age 13, many boys' testicles have started producing sperm, but other boys (including myself) did not start producing the little tadpoles until later. At the onset of puberty, boys will start having sexual dreams at night, with erections, and later, when they reach full puberty, the sexual dream will end with an ejaculation of sperm and semen into his pajamas or onto the sheets. That is a "wet dream". I remember having "wet dreams" beginning at about age 14, and after having one, getting a towel or kleenex to clean up the sticky mess. Later on I learned to wake up before I had the "wet dream", so I would not make the mess. Once a boy regularly starts masturbating to orgasm, the wet dreams usually disappear.
